Abstract

In the world of design, themes and concepts become fundamental. Themes and concepts cover the whole idea of a work, as well as in the field of digital imaging. Ideas can be taken from nearby environments such as natural beauty of wood texture. The idea used in the creation of digital imaging is wood texture. The process is the pre-production and production stage. Methods consisting of idea stages, data collection, stage of embodiment, and finalization. At the idea stage, it is attempted to visualize and represent the wood texture through digital imaging techniques. This idea was raised based on believes that wood texture has the aesthetic textures to be applied to digital imaging illustration. Data collection is done through observation. While at the stage of embodiment the process carried out is to make editing image through Adobe Photoshop software. Finalization done with export the illustration in JPG format. The result of this creation is an illustrative work resulting from the digital imaging process entitled Dream Land. It is the process of uniting and editing multiple images into one relevant entity.
